KBR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2014 in Review

325 of the 3,463 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in KBR (KBR) for Q1 2014, worth a combined $3.52B — down 20% from $4.4B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 50 funds closed out of KBR and 44 opened new positions — a net loss of 6 holders — while 132 trimmed existing stakes and 110 added.

The largest buyer was Franklin Resources, opening a new position worth an estimated $102M. The largest seller was Wellington Management Group, cutting an estimated $127M.
